Let us not forget AD played 24 games total between 2022-2025 on account of injury, not his fault, but the club stuck with him and he got paid, got a chance to perform when he returned, did perform and we offered him an extension. At all those moments there were not other clubs banging the door down to sign AD, it was Tigers giving him the chance to perform and stay on the books.

He has a few good months and now cannot play where Benji puts him? That's rich if true, because the reality is AD is a great athlete but not a good enough footballer to ever iron out one position, and that's saying a lot from being part of such an ordinary Tigers side for 7 seasons.

But even look at his time with Souths - 2018 he debuted at halfback Rd 2 and kicked goals, then off the bench for 4 rounds, then centre, fullback, centre before another 4 rounds on the bench. Finished the season on the wing and actually won 9 out of his final 10 games of 2018 before doing, surprise surprise, his ACL.

2019 played centre and halfback before settling in to fullback for 12 weeks including the finals series that ended with a loss to Raiders in the Prelim. Squeezed out of Souths to make way for Latrell - was told he would be second-choice and was permitted to explore options, so he did.

Most of 2020 as Tigers fullback, then 5/8th and centre mix for 2021. Bench, centre and 5/8th for 2022, 5/8th and FB for 2023, centre for all of his 7 matches in 2024, centre for most of 2025 but stints at HB, 5/8th and lock. HB all of 2026 for a win rate of 5W 7L.

Where in his personal history has Doueihi ever tied down a position as assuredly his own, no questions on his performances or selection. Answer is never, he has always been a positional journeyman because he's not quite agile enough in attack or defence, doesn't make great contact in tackles, but is a good ball runner and fit enough to play all game. But that's on him, two clubs have given AD more than enough time to cement a position.
